The size of a fret refers to the width and height of the fret wire, and more specifically, the crown (also known as the bead) of the fret wire. The amount of fret wire needed for one guitar varies, but a standard estimate is around 5 to 6 feet of fret wire. Find the perfect fret wire for your guitar.
